Geodon and Psoriasis - a phase IV clinical study of FDA data
Summary:
Psoriasis is reported as a side effect among people who take Geodon (ziprasidone hydrochloride), especially for people who are female, 40-49 old, have been taking the drug for 2 - 5 years also take Humira, and have Insomnia.
The phase IV clinical study analyzes which people have Psoriasis when taking Geodon. It is created by eHealthMe based on reports of 18,215 people who have side effects when taking Geodon from the FDA, and is updated regularly.

18,215 people reported to have side effects when taking Geodon.
Among them, 23 people (0.13%) have Psoriasis.

Among these 23 people:
How long have people been on Geodon when they have Psoriasis? *
- < 1 month: 0.0 %
- 1 - 6 months: 0.0 %
- 6 - 12 months: 0.0 %
- 1 - 2 years: 50 %
- 2 - 5 years: 50 %
- 5 - 10 years: 0.0 %
- 10+ years: 0.0 %
What is the gender of people who have Psoriasis when taking Geodon? *
- female: 85.71 %
- male: 14.29 %
What is the age of people who have Psoriasis when taking Geodon? *
- 0-1: 0.0 %
- 2-9: 0.0 %
- 10-19: 0.0 %
- 20-29: 15 %
- 30-39: 25 %
- 40-49: 35 %
- 50-59: 15 %
- 60+: 10 %

How the study uses the data?
The study uses data from the FDA. It is based on ziprasidone hydrochloride (the active ingredients of Geodon) and Geodon (the brand name). Other drugs that have the same active ingredients (e.g. generic drugs) are not considered. Dosage of drugs is not considered in the study.
